Чтение куки - PullRequest
       2

Чтение куки

1 голос
/ 06 октября 2011

Когда я делаю:

print_r($_COOKIE[@PATH]);

Возвращает хороший массив:

Массив (['threads'] => Массив ([12] => Массив ([50] => 1317830223 [1] => 1317785487 [14] => 1317497737 [7] => 1317488004 [9] => 1317485889 [6] => 1317294825 [5] => 1317289974 [4] => 1317288063)))

Но когда я это сделаю:

print_r($_COOKIE[@PATH]['threads']);

Он ничего не печатает ... var_dump также возвращает NULL.

Что с этим не так? Первая печать говорит, что есть такой массив, но когда я пытаюсь его перехватить, скрипт возвращает ноль.

1 Ответ

1 голос
/ 06 октября 2011

Судя по внешнему виду вашего массива, ваш массив cookie содержит ключ с именем 'threads', а не threads.Эти кавычки являются частью имени ключа, поэтому где-то вы добавляете посторонние кавычки к ключу.

Попробуйте print_r($_COOKIE[@PATH]["'threads'"]);, чтобы понять, о чем я.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...